What is Nucoshine 120 Mg?
Nucoshine 120 Mg is a prescription medication containing the active ingredient Etoricoxib, which belongs to the class of drugs known as selective COX-2 inhibitors. How Nucoshine 120 Mg Works
The active ingredient in Nucoshine 120 Mg, Etoricoxib, works by selectively inhibiting the cyclooxygenase-2 (COX-2) enzyme. This enzyme plays a key role in the production of prostaglandins, which cause pain and inflammation in the body. By blocking COX-2, Nucoshine 120 Mg helps to reduce inflammation and pain without affecting the COX-1 enzyme, which protects the stomach lining. This selective action minimizes gastrointestinal side effects compared to traditional n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s).

Who Should Avoid Nucoshine 120 Mg?
Individuals with known hypersensitivity to Etoricoxib or other COX-2 inhibitors should avoid Nucoshine 120 Mg. It is contraindicated in patients with active gastrointestinal bleeding, severe heart failure, or those who have experienced asthma, urticaria, or allergic-type reactions after taking aspirin or other NSAIDs.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should seek medical advice before use, as safety data is limited.
Possible Side Effects
While Nucoshine 120 Mg is generally well tolerated, some patients may experience side effects. Common side effects include headache, dizziness, gastrointestinal discomfort, nausea, or swelling of the limbs. Serious side effects, although rare, can include cardiovascular events, severe allergic reactions, or liver enzyme abnormalities. Notify your healthcare provider immediately if you experience chest pain, shortness of breath, severe skin reactions, or persistent abdominal pain.

Drug Interactions
Nucoshine 120 Mg may interact with several medications, including blood thinners (anticoagulants), other NSAIDs, diuretics, and certain antihypertensive drugs.
